Aspects of th press in the United States and United Kingdom have needed to be held to account for their lies and overt sensationalism for a very long time. The problem is he's launched an all out assault on those also telling the truth. For all his protestations he wants biased, fake news. His supporters want biased, fake news. You take away the press and all belief in it and you kill democracy.

It's a disaster. And the press are themselves to blame in many respects. The lack of a regulator in the USA like Ofcom to make sure the news that goes out on TV is balanced and as factual as possible is another massive problem. In the U.K. the majority of news is still consumed via the BBC, Sky News, ITV News and Channel 4 via TV, online and radio. It's the wall, the barrier, against websites and newspapers that lean a certain way. Fox News pioneered this monster and its grown ever since.
